Abstract

An improved gate assembly and gate control assembly for operatively controlling the movement of the gate assembly in material discharging equipment is provided wherein the gate assembly comprises a first and second clamshell gate member, a connecting assembly for pivotably connecting the first and second clamshell gate members to the equipment and substantially synchronizing the movement of the first and second clamshell gate members between a closed position, and an open position, a gate moving assembly operably connected to the first and second clamshell gate members for moving the first and second gate members between the closed and the open position, and the gate control assembly operably connected to the gate moving assembly, the gate control assembly selectively activating the gate moving assembly such that the first and second gate clamshell members are moved between the closed position and the open position. The gate control assembly is further characterized as having a first operational mode and a second operational mode. In the first operational mode the gate control assembly is acutated for positive closure of the first and second clamshell gate members. In the second operational mode the gate control assembly selectively moving the first and second clamshell gate members between the closed position and the open position.
